Why only apply flaps at rotation speed?
@flyingdundee43
@flyingdundee43 3 ай бұрын
Hello Ricardo, good question. On a normal ground roll you can accelerate faster without flaps. However this is not necessary for a trailer takeoff. But for trailer takeoffs the aircraft is positioned with a nose down attitude because liftoff is at a higher than normal speed (about 10 knots higher) and you don’t want the aircraft to start to float before reaching this speed. If you have flaps on during the roll you have a greater risk of moving on the trailer before you are ready to takeoff. So flaps are pulled on at rotation. However I have learned they should be pulled on more slowly than in this video due to the weight of a 180. Hope this answers your question. Cheers from Canada.
